Abbreviations

MR – magic ring

Rnd (R) – round

ch – chain

st/sts – stitch/stitches

sc – single crochet

dc – double crochet

inc – increase (2 sc in one stitch)

dec – decrease (2 sc together)

hdc – half double crochet

sl st – slip stitch

FV: increase single double stitch

E (tr): double double stitch

Fw: 3 double crochet in common foot

2cht: go up 2 rows then slide the stitch into the 2 strings at the front half of the previous sc stitch.

 

Flower (x11)

R1: MR 8sc

R2: 8sc

R3: 5ch, back, 2nd leg 4sc, slst 2nd st R2, slst into 3rd st R2 (repeat 4 times)

R4: Crochet into 4 petal edges: sc, hdc, 2dc, FW, 2dc, hdc, dc,… (repeat 4 times)

 

Leaf (x2)

R1: 18ch, zinc strip

R2: 2nd leg: sc, hdc, dc, 6E, 2dc, 2hdc, 3sc, (sc, 2ch, sc), 3sc, 2hdc,

2dc, 6E, dc, hdc, sc

R3: hdc, dc, 5FV, 4dc, 3hdc, 4sc, (sc, 2ch, sc), 4sc, 3hdc, 4dc, 5FV, dc, hdc

 

Buds (x3)

R1: MR 4sc

R2: 4inc

R3: 8sc

R4-7: sc, dec
